Retry semantics: 5 attempts, exponential backoff starting at 2s, capped at 10m, jitter ±20%. A delivery is terminal after a 4xx other than 429. Every retry decision is logged with the dispatcher build identity so we can correlate behavior changes across releases — backoff tuning has shipped three times this year. New team members: never diagnose retry storms without first pinning the exact build. Provenance lives in the artifact manifest, signed at merge. The current production dispatcher carries the token below.

pipeline stamp: htk21_104c5ba7d0df6b2897cd5

14:22 — Turnstile counter drift confirmed at Marrowgate Stadium. The Gatewren counter service double-counted rotations when the south-bank sensors reconnected after the network blip at 14:07, inflating attendance figures by roughly four percent. We froze the aggregate feed, replayed raw sensor events from the buffer, and verified corrected totals against manual gate logs. The patched counter build that future maintainers should deploy is identified by the token below.

build token for kagaf-hahof: htk14_9d3d4d26d7d8de

14:02 — ScanBridge barcode integration at Korvex Depot began rejecting valid EAN payloads. 14:09 — Traced to the Lintman parser update that tightened checksum validation. 14:17 — Rolled back parser; scans resumed. 14:31 — Confirmed no malformed payloads reached the Orna inventory service. No credential exposure observed. Rollback artifact was signed and verified before deploy. The trace token for the failing build follows below.

pipeline stamp: htk31_f769b577b3028a4e9958e5bb8d1259a